1.1 Overview of the ZOLL AED Plus Device
The ZOLL AED Plus is an automated external defibrillator (AED) designed to provide real-time guidance during cardiac emergencies. It features voice and visual prompts, Real CPR Help technology, and compatibility with pediatric electrodes. Lightweight and portable, it is ideal for both professional and public settings, ensuring effective defibrillation and CPR support. 2.1 Real CPR Help Technology
Real CPR Help technology provides real-time audio and visual feedback on chest compression depth and rate, ensuring high-quality CPR. It guides rescuers to meet recommended guidelines, enhancing the effectiveness of manual compressions during emergencies.

5.1 Device Weight and Portability
The ZOLL AED Plus weighs approximately 6.7 pounds, making it highly portable for emergency response situations. Its compact design allows easy transportation in vehicles or carrying by hand. Constructed with durability in mind, the device is lightweight yet robust, ensuring reliability in critical moments. Its portability enhances accessibility, enabling quick deployment in various settings, from public spaces to remote locations.
5.2 Compatibility with Pediatric Electrodes
The ZOLL AED Plus is compatible with pediatric electrodes, such as the Pedi-Padz, ensuring safe and effective use for children under 8 years old or weighing less than 25 kg; These electrodes are specifically designed for pediatric emergencies, providing appropriate energy delivery while maintaining the device’s ease of use. Proper electrode selection is crucial for optimal performance and patient safety in emergency situations.
